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90423920 79 60796490 10755362
79969169 69507 99326575695
79969169 69507 99326575695
49476982879 802690061 21654 2309
All about undefined
Interested in learning more?
79969169 69507 99326575695
49476982879 802690061 21654 2309
See more
48188202 82269 596200468
133452993 5496346 75
See more
12 651785
14046 9538 5213
See more